Maltézské nám∂stí
The Knights of Malta once
had an autonomous settlement
here, and the square still bears
their name. The area is dominated
by beautiful Baroque palaces, and
the 12th-century Church of Our
Lady Below the Chain - so called
for the Marian portrait inside that
hangs beneath chains from the
Judith Bridge, the precursor to
Charles Bridge. d Map C3

Church of Our Lady
Victorious
More popularly known as the
Church of the Infant Jesus of
Prague, Prague's first Baroque
church (1611) got its name - and
its Catholic outlook - after the
Battle of White Mountain (see
p34) . Visitors stream in to the
church to see the miracle-
working statue of the Christ Child
(see p38) . d Karmelitská 9 • Map C3

Vojanovy sady
Malá Strana has many green
pockets, but Vojan's gardens top
them all for their romantic charm.
Tulip beds, flowering fruit trees
and the occasional peacock add
to the fairytale atmosphere (see
p40) . d U lu≈ického seminá∫e • Map D2
